The Coconut Charcoal Making Machine will be able to process around 3 a lot of coconut shells inside an hour. These machines have increased in popularity throughout the years due to their high-cost performance and efficiency, along with a approach to recycle waste which will take up space in landfills.


Coconut shells are among the common types of organic waste mainly located in the coastal regions, which is assigned to an increased recycling value. The Coconut Charcoal Making Machine converts the coconut waste into charcoal using carbonization. The shells are then reprocessed and changed into activated-charcoal. This end product is in high demand and gives investors an outstanding technique to generate profits.


Most importantly, this kind of machinery can also be used for processing other sorts of organic waste including sawdust, rice husk, wood, straw, and even sewage sludge to make various kinds of charcoals.

How Is Charcoal Made Out Of Coconut Shells?

To start with, the coconut shells are first shredded into smaller pieces of under 40mm. From here the crushed shells travel along a conveyor belt right into a quantitative feeder. The feeder then sends the shells in a drying host in which the materials are flash steamed and dried.


The dry coconut shells then fall into the furnace where these are carbonized. The temperature within the furnace rapidly rises, and this is the time pyrolysis occurs. Charcoal will be the end product generated through several processes including desulfurization and discharging.


When the fuel actually starts to burn, the residual gas is then employed to heat the drying system which assists to conserve energy. The combustible gas that is certainly manufactured by the carbonization process will then be shipped to a cyclone dust-collector, in which the gas is de-dusted and purified. The gas will be separated into vinegar and wood tar which is then recycled to heat the furnace externally.
